Converting 0.020 to a Fraction

In this article, we will learn how to convert the decimal number 0.020 to a fraction.

Converting 0.020 to a Fraction

To convert 0.020 to a fraction, we can use the following steps:

  1. Divide the decimal number by the denominator (in this case, 1).
  2. Count the number of decimal places in the decimal number. In this case, there are 3 decimal places (0.020).
  3. Multiply both the numerator and denominator by 10 to the power of the number of decimal places (10^3 = 1000).
  4. Simplify the fraction by dividing both the numerator and denominator by their greatest common divisor (GCD).

Let's apply these steps to 0.020:

Step 1: Divide by 1

0.020 ÷ 1 = 0.020

Step 2: Count decimal places

There are 3 decimal places in 0.020.

Step 3: Multiply by 10^3

0.020 × 1000 = 20 1 × 1000 = 1000

Step 4: Simplify

20 ÷ 20 = 1 1000 ÷ 20 = 50

So, 0.020 can be converted to a fraction as follows:

0.020 = 1/50

There you have it! We have successfully converted the decimal number 0.020 to a fraction, which is 1/50.
